Morricone soundtracks: Storie Di Vita, Il Giorno, Gli Occhiali D'Oro

Hi, this is my first post here. I'm wondering if anyone could tell me what Morricone's scores for Storie Di Vita, Il Giorno & Gli Occhiali D'Oro are like or how they stack up against his gizillion other scores?

Il Giorno Prima is somber but very good. Some powerful choral work stands out.

Gli Occhiali D'Oro is great. Very melodic. If you enjoy Cinema Paradiso, I'd wager you will enjoy this as well.

I would agree with Michael and add that Storie Di Vita is the weakest of the three you mention ... tuneful, melodic as (nearly) always but nothing - to date for me - that makes it stand out against many of his other scores.

I mention "to date" because I do find, especially with the Maestro's works, that repeated playings improve the listening experience. Gli Occhiali D'Oro is a prime example: originally "just one of the crowd" this is now a score that I really look forward to playing ... there is so much in it.

The choral work in Il Giorno Prima is brilliant.
